In a broader sense, the idea of demanding royalties for showing an image of a product seems absurd to me.

Imagine if I took a photograph of my room, and sold that photo for $20. The company that made my furniture would want their piece of the $20. The company that made my computer would want their piece. The company that made my carpet would want their piece. And so on.

Pretty soon, these royalties would be more than the $20 I made. Were this the case, it would be impossible to produce any kind of media.

It's mind boggling absurd and impractical that any company should demand royalties for displaying an image of their product. It's reprehensible that any would get away with it, and only then because of legal loopholes and bullying.
